When creating traces for tools like RGP or using SPM or doing performance profiling, it's required to enable a special stable profiling power state on the GPU. These profiling states set fixed clocks and disable certain other power features like powergating which may impact the results. Historically, these profiling pstates were enabled via sysfs, but this adds an interface to enable it via the CTX ioctl from the application. Since the power state is global only one application can set it at a time, so if multiple applications try and use it only the first will get it, the ioctl will return -EBUSY for others. The sysfs interface will override whatever has been set by this interface. It has the same shape as Tile Y at two granularities: 4KB (128B x 32) and 64B (16B x 4). It only differs from Tile Y at the 256B granularity in between. At this granularity, Tile Y has a shape of 16B x 32 rows, but this tiling has a shape of 64B x 8 rows. As the seqno fence is simply an incrementing counter which is local to the submitqueue, it is easy for userspace to know the next value. This is useful for native userspace drivers in a vm guest, as the guest to host roundtrip can have high latency. Assigning the fence seqno in the guest userspace allows the guest to continue without waiting for response from the host. The one remaining synchronous "hotpath" is buffer allocation, because guest needs to wait to know the bo's iova before it can start emitting cmdstream/state that references the new bo. By allocating the iova in the guest userspace, we no longer need to wait for a response from the host, but can just rely on the allocation request being processed before the cmdstream submission.
